Many relationships between foreigners and Thai women start with an ocean between them, whether because the foreigner went home after a holiday or the relationship began online before either of them booked a flight. Here we gather stories about the waiting, the time zones, and the trust that long distance demands — and what happened once it ended, one way or another. Stories like Mali's, who talked to her partner every day for years before living together, show that distance itself doesn't predict the outcome — consistency does.
